There is no way of knowing whether the kink is caused by temp. fluctuations during incubation, injury to the hatchling or some genetic defect in the snake. Personally, I wouldn't use her for breeding because of that.
She should have went on to a "pet home" with full disclosure and at a heavily discounted price.
